Europe to see increase in petroleum, other liquids output

European petroleum and other liquids production will stand at 4.25 million barrels per day in 2022, as compared to 4.14 mbd in 2021, Trend reports with reference to the US Energy Information Administration (EIA).

EIA estimates Europe’s quarterly production at 4.32 mbd, 3.84 mbd and 4.13 mbd in the first three quarters of 2021 each, and forecasts this figure at 4.28 mbd in Q4 2021.

The quarterly forecasts for 2022 are as follows: 4.30 mbd, 4.22 mbd, 4.11 mbd and 4.39 mbd in Q1, Q2, Q3 and Q4 2022, respectively.

The volume of production in Europe was 4.22 mbd as of 2020, according to EIA.

In particular, EIA expects Norway to produce 2.05 mbd and 2.16 mbd in 2021 and 2022 respectively, as compared to 2.01 mbd in 2020. UK’s output is set to drop from 1.08 mbd in 2020 to 0.95 mbd in 2021, before recovering to 0.97 mbd in 2022.
